白细胞介素-1β对血浆催产素和精氨酸加压素的影响:肾上腺类固醇的作用及给药途径

Interleukin-1 beta-induced effects on plasma oxytocin and arginine vasopressin: role of adrenal steroids and route of administration.

Abstract

The effects of cytokines in stimulating neurohypophysial hormone release have not been well characterized. In the present study, we have investigated the effect of intraperitoneal injection of recombinant human interleukin (IL)-1 beta on oxytocin release in sham-operated controls, adrenalectomized (ADX) rats and ADX rats given either low or high doses of the synthesis glucocorticoid dexamethasone. In a second study, we determined the effect of central injection of IL-1 beta on both oxytocin and arginine vasopressin (AVP) release in sham-operated and ADX rats. We were unable to demonstrate an increase in plasma oxytocin in intact rats in response to intraperitoneal injection of IL-1 beta. In contrast, we found a substantial and sustained increase in plasma oxytocin concentrations in ADX rats. This stimulation was abolished by treatment with dexamethasone at both the low and high doses. Following central injection of IL-1 beta, we were unable to demonstrate any increase in either oxytocin or AVP, despite the ability of this dose of cytokine to stimulate the hypothalamo-pituitary-adrenal axis, as evidenced by increased circulating corticosterone. It appears that circulating glucocorticoids may exert a tonic inhibitory effect on the release of oxytocin in response to peripheral stimulation by IL-1 beta.

摘要

细胞因子在刺激神经垂体激素释放方面的作用尚未得到充分阐明。在本研究中,我们研究了腹腔注射重组人白细胞介素(IL)-1β对假手术对照组、肾上腺切除(ADX)大鼠以及给予低剂量或高剂量合成糖皮质激素地塞米松的ADX大鼠中催产素释放的影响。在第二项研究中,我们测定了向假手术和ADX大鼠中枢注射IL-1β对催产素和精氨酸加压素(AVP)释放的影响。我们未能证明完整大鼠腹腔注射IL-1β后血浆催产素增加。相反,我们发现ADX大鼠血浆催产素浓度有显著且持续的升高。低剂量和高剂量地塞米松治疗均可消除这种刺激。向中枢注射IL-1β后,尽管该剂量的细胞因子能够刺激下丘脑-垂体-肾上腺轴,循环皮质酮增加可证明这一点,但我们未能证明催产素或AVP有任何增加。似乎循环糖皮质激素可能对IL-1β外周刺激引起的催产素释放产生紧张性抑制作用。
